Transaction 3955eb4b9d81549bdcd427eb24d62f23b5ac2c8e32a0b1a150f629f1176605de

1 Input
2 Outputs
  • 3955eb4b9d81549bdcd427eb24d62f23b5ac2c8e32a0b1a150f629f1176605de:0
  • value  669609
    address  1CN7tfd2wgygn4rfwWhsqi84bZ9uNZf18W
  • 3955eb4b9d81549bdcd427eb24d62f23b5ac2c8e32a0b1a150f629f1176605de:1
  • value  89592278
    address  3Pbx6TdgPKTHTVx6zwTJjFCcEBhkzaykbw